Package: src:linux Severity: wishlist Tags: patch kthxbye Howdy, maintainers, It'd be great to set CONFIG_NETLABEL=y. I'm interested in packaging some tools that depend on this flag. This feature enables the usage of tools such as CIPSO, RIPSO, or CALIPSO, which enable the tagging of IP packets between two cooperating hosts. I submitted an MR to Salsa[1] Thank you for your work!
